Amends section 1142(b) by inserting text in paragraph (5) and striking paragraph (11) and replacing it with new paragraph (11) requiring information concerning mental health (subparagraphs (A)–(G)).
Amends section 6320(b)(1) by redesignating subparagraphs (G) and (H) as (I) and (J), and inserting new subparagraphs (G) and (H).
Requires the Department of Defense’s Transition Assistance Program to include information and counseling on mental health, suicide risk, substance abuse, and stresses tied to separating from military service. Directs the Department of Veterans Affairs’ Solid Start outreach to help eligible veterans enroll in VA patient enrollment and to provide education about VHA mental-health services and counseling. The Secretaries of Defense and Veterans Affairs must jointly report to specified congressional committees within one year describing implementation.
